The Druck PV411 is a high-performance, portable pressure calibrator and pump, renowned for its robustness and exceptional accuracy. It serves as a primary standard for calibrating pressure instruments, transmitters, switches, and gauges. The unique dual-mode operation allows it to generate pressure using either a built-in hydraulic system (for oil) or by connecting to an external pneumatic source (for gas), making it an incredibly versatile tool for calibration laboratories and field service technicians.

Detailed Features and Specifications
1. Dual Pressure Generation System:
-
Hydraulic Mode: Uses internal hand pumps and a reservoir filled with high-purity, compatible oil (e.g., Druck DPM1, DC100, or similar) to generate very stable and high pressures up to 700 bar. Ideal for high-pressure hydraulic applications.
-
Pneumatic Mode: Connects to an external, clean, dry air or gas supply (e.g., nitrogen bottle) to generate pressure. This mode is used for lower pressure pneumatic devices and is typically faster for repetitive tasks.
2. Precision and Performance:
-
High Accuracy: When used with a high-accuracy pressure sensor (like the Druck DPI 104, which it was often bundled with), the system can achieve accuracies as high as 0.025% of reading.
-
Excellent Stability: The precision-machined piston and valve system ensures highly stable pressure control, essential for precise calibration and measurement.
-
Fine Pressure Control: Features a finely threaded control knob that allows for minute adjustments of pressure, enabling technicians to “dial in” on a specific pressure setpoint with ease.
3. Design and Construction:
-
Robust and Portable: Housed in a durable, hard-case design with a comfortable carrying handle, built to withstand the rigors of field and workshop use.
-
Intuitive Interface: The pump features clearly marked hydraulic and pneumatic ports, a fluid reservoir, and a vent valve.
-
Materials: Constructed with materials compatible with both hydraulic fluids and non-corrosive gases to ensure long-term reliability.
4. Connectivity:
-
Equipped with standard high-pressure connectors (e.g., 1/4″ BSP or NPT) for connecting to the Device Under Test (DUT).
-
Separate ports for the pneumatic supply and hydraulic system.

Typical Applications
The Druck PV411 is used to calibrate and test a wide range of pressure equipment, including:
-
Pressure Transmitters and Transducers
-
Mechanical Pressure Gauges (Test Gauges)
-
Pressure Switches
-
Blood Pressure Monitors (for hydraulic simulation)
-
Process control instruments in industries like Oil & Gas, Power Generation, Aerospace, and Manufacturing.
